WebBoil. Add the rinsed pieces to boiling water. Add a teaspoon of salt and leave the breadfruit pieces to soften – this can take anywhere from 15 minutes to 30 minutes. Once completely soft, strain the breadfruit and rinse. Sometimes, the sticky latex will leach into the water and it is better to rinse it out. Harvesting equipment: The first step in processing breadfruit is to harvest the fruit from the tree. Harvesting equipment such as ladders, picking poles, and pruning saws can be used to safely and efficiently gather the fruits.
